Arrests follow force drug blitz

Three people were arrested after £10,000 worth of drugs were recovered during a raid on a house on Teesside.

Several ounces of heroin valued at £7,000 and crack cocaine worth £3,000 were found at the house in Marton Grove Road, Middlesbrough, on Saturday.

A 22-year-old man was later charged with possessing class A drugs with intent to supply.

Cleveland Police also arrested two women during the raid but they were later released without charge.
